Swaptober Kicks into Gear in Anticipation of Skylanders Swap Force

Skylanders-SWAP-Force_NightIn anticipation of the Skylanders Swap Force launch, Activision Publishing Inc. is using the month of October, or “Swaptober” to get gamers ready for the game’s launch on October 13. Lucky Portal Masters will have chances to win copies of the Skylanders Swap Force game, explore the world of Skylanders in Times Square, and more during the month-long activities.

To kick off Swaptober, Activision will be giving away one Skylanders Swap Force Starter Pack per day beginning October 1 and going to October 31 via the official Skylanders Twitter channel (@SkylandersGame). For a chance to win, portal masters can visit Skylanders.com to mix and match their favorite character combination and then tweet it along with a suggested catch phrase using hashtags #SWAPtober and #Skylanders.

There are even more ways to celebrate on  October 10, when Skylanders partners with Toys “R” Us to bring Skylanders to life with “Swaptoberfest”—a celebration in Times Square where fans will have the chance to be among the very first to play the game before it’s available at retail. This Times Square takeover will feature Skylanders Swap Force-themed activities, photos with Skylanders costumed characters, and chances to win Starter Packs and Skylanders-themed merchandise from companies, including Mega Brands, Rubie’s Costume Co., Hybrid Apparel, and Power A.

Visit the Toys “R” Us international flagship store in New York City on October 12 to 13 for a one-of-a-kind in-store experience,  including game demos and giveaways for the official Skylanders Swap Force launch. The game will be available on Xbox 360, Playstation 3, Nintendo Wii, Nintendo Wii U, and Nintendo 3DS.
